Aspartic acid is a type of amino acid. Amino acids are used as building blocks to make protein in the body. One type of aspartic acid, called D-aspartic acid, is not used to make protein, but it is used in other body functions. People use aspartic acid for fatigue, athletic performance, and muscle strength. Aspartic acid the ionic form is known as aspartate is an α-amino acid that is used in the biosynthesis of proteins. It is a non-essential amino acid in humans, meaning the body can synthesize it as needed. D-Aspartate is one of two D-amino acids commonly found in mammals.
